  1. CN Tower: An iconic symbol of Toronto, the CN Tower offers breathtaking panoramic views of the city from its observation deck. Experience the thrill of the glass floor and enjoy fine dining at the 360 Restaurant, all while surrounded by stunning city vibes.
  2. Metro Toronto Convention Centre: This bustling venue hosts a variety of events and conferences, making it a hub for business and networking. Its contemporary design and strategic location provide a vibrant atmosphere for professionals.
  3. University of Toronto - St. George Campus: A historic campus with stunning architecture and lush green spaces, it offers a rich cultural experience. Explore its museums, galleries, and vibrant student life, all amidst a backdrop of academic excellence.

Best time to go to Rosedale

If you're planning a trip to Rosedale, it's a good idea to check both the weather and property rates. The warmest month is July. Peak season runs in April and June to July, while off-peak times, like January and October to November tend to have fewer bookings and better deals.
